Banana Nut Cake 2 Recipe

Ingredients
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ups sugar
  • 1 teaspoon each baking powder, baking soda, salt, ground cinnamon and nutmeg
  • 4 eggs, lightly beaten
  • 1-1/3 cups vegetable oil
  • 1-1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 can (8 ounces) crushed pineapple, undrained
  • 2 cups mashed ripe bananas (3 to 4 medium)
  • 1-1/2 cups chopped walnuts
  • Confectioners' sugar

Directions
  1. In a mixing bowl, combine dry ingredients.
  2. Beat in eggs, oil and vanilla.
  3. Fold in pineapple, bananas and nuts.
  4. Pour in to a well-greased 10-in. tube pan.
  5. Bake at 350 degrees for 60-65 minutes or until cake tests done.
  6. Cool in pan 15 minutes before removing to a wire rack.
  7. When completely cooled, dust with confectioners' sugar.
  8. Yield: 12-16 servings.
